Clean removals that preserve the shot

Wire and rig removal is rarely just a paint task. It often requires roto, tracking, clean plate reconstruction, edge repair, grain matching, and careful attention to motion, shadow, reflections, and depth. Studio8FX brings those pieces together so the final result feels photographed, not patched.

We support stunt sequences, practical effects, creature or prop rigs, harness removal, marker removal, crew and equipment cleanup, and complex plate repairs around moving actors or cameras. When a removal overlaps hair, wardrobe, smoke, water, reflections, or fast camera movement, we plan the approach before the shot becomes expensive downstream.

What affects the cost and schedule of wire removal?

The main factors are frame count, camera and subject motion, occlusions, clean-plate availability, background complexity, hair or wardrobe overlap, reflections, shadows, resolution, and review requirements.
